Why Learning to Speak Spanish is Beneficial

Spanish is the second most spoken language in the world by native speakers, with over 480 million people using it daily. Understanding and speaking Spanish can enhance your travel experiences, improve career prospects, and deepen your connection to Hispanic cultures. Additionally, learning a new language has cognitive benefits such as improved memory, problem-solving skills, and better multitasking.

Global Reach of Spanish

– Spoken in over 20 countries across Latin America, Spain, and the United States
– Official language of many international organizations such as the UN and the EU
– Increasing demand for bilingual professionals in healthcare, education, and business sectors

Personal and Professional Advantages

– Access to diverse literature, music, and film in original Spanish
– Enhanced communication skills and cultural sensitivity
– Competitive edge in job markets where Spanish is valuable

Challenges for Beginners Learning to Speak Spanish

Starting to speak Spanish can be intimidating due to differences in grammar, pronunciation, and vocabulary. Common hurdles include mastering verb conjugations, understanding gendered nouns, and developing listening comprehension skills.

Common Difficulties

– Verb tenses and moods (e.g., subjunctive) can be complex
– Pronunciation of rolled “r” and certain vowel sounds
– Gender agreement between nouns and adjectives
– Differentiating between formal and informal speech

Building a Strong Foundation: Key Grammar and Pronunciation Tips

Understanding fundamental grammar and pronunciation rules is essential for effective communication.

Basic Grammar Points

Noun Gender and Articles: Spanish nouns have genders (masculine or feminine), which affect the articles and adjectives used. For example, “el libro” (the book – masculine), “la casa” (the house – feminine).
Verb Conjugation: Start with present tense conjugations of regular verbs ending in -ar, -er, and -ir. For example, “hablar” (to speak) becomes “yo hablo” (I speak).
Subject Pronouns: Often omitted in Spanish, but important for clarity when learning. Examples include “yo” (I), “tú” (you informal), “él/ella” (he/she).

Pronunciation Essentials

– The Spanish alphabet is mostly phonetic, meaning words are pronounced as they are written.
– Practice the rolled “r” sound, which is common in words like “perro” (dog).
– Pay attention to vowel sounds: Spanish vowels are pure and consistent (a, e, i, o, u).
– Recognize the difference between “b” and “v” sounds, which are often pronounced similarly.
